What is iCloud+, and its features?

It was WWDC 2021 when Apple first announced the rebranding of iCloud to iCloud+. And it has started to roll out alongside iOS 15 and iPadOS 15. However, you wouldn’t have noticed it, unless you would have been specifically looking for it.

The new name is almost similar to other Apple paid services, and there aren’t any major changes, compared to the services iCloud offers. It isn’t any premium or VIP add-on, it’s just a rebranding of iCloud.

Apple said, “iCloud+ combines everything users love about iCloud with new premium features, including Hide My Email, expanded HomeKit Secure Video support, and an innovative new internet privacy service, iCloud Private Relay, at no additional cost. “

With the introduction of Hide My Email, and Private Relay, iCloud + is mainly focusing on privacy. We can also see an improvement in HomeKit Secure Video storage.

You will automatically be shifted to iCloud+ just after upgrading to iOS 15, only if you are a paid iCloud user. Plus, all the services will be activated automatically at no additional cost.

From when will you get iCloud+?

The iCloud+ was made officially available after iOS 15 and iPad OS 15 on September 20. It means that iCloud+ is available for your device. All you have to do is download the latest software update for your iOS device, i.e. iOS 15.

However, iCloud+ will be available for Mac users by the end of 2021.

iCloud+ : Pricing

The iCloud was having different storage options and each pair had different pricing. But now, with the arrival of iCloud+, the storage, as well as the pricing, have changed. Here are the new storage plans.

  • 50GB – $0.99/month
  • 200GB – $2.99/month
  • 2TB – $9.99/ month

Even after the rebranding, Apple will continue to provide free iCloud plans.

How to Get iCloud+ for Free?

Even after the rebranding of iCloud to iCloud+, Apple will continue to provide its free services. You will continue to get 5GB of storage for free. And, in case you think you need more storage you can shift to the premium plans anytime.

However, if you are not using the premium plan, and have decided to stick with the 5GB free plan, then you won’t get the newly added services of iCloud+  like Private Relay, Hide My Email, HomeKit Secure Video storage, and custom domain.
